파일 핸들링 API

C++ 2011. 2. 3. 21:55


C/C++ 표준 파일 제어 API
열기 FILE* fopen() 신규 혹은 기존 파일 열기
읽기 size_t fread() 파일에서 지정된 바이트 수 만큼 읽기
char* fgets() 파일에서 한 줄 읽기
int fgetc() 파일에서 한 문자 읽기
쓰기 size_t fwrite() 파일에 지정된 바이트 수 만큼 쓰기
char* fputs() 파일에 한 줄 쓰기
int fputc() 파일에 한 문자 쓰기
닫기 int fclose() 파일 닫기

Windows 파일 제어 API
열기 CreateFile() fopen()에 대응
읽기 ReadFile() fread()에 대응
쓰기 WriteFile() fwrite()에 대응
닫기 CloseHandle() fclose()에 대응
이동 SetFilePointer()





'C++' 카테고리의 다른 글

warning LNK4099: 'vc90.pdb'  (0) 2011.03.25
CRT 이야기 [펌]  (0) 2011.02.14
IPC (inter-process communication)  (0) 2011.02.03
LocalAlloc, GlobalAlloc, HeapAlloc, VirtualAlloc  (0) 2011.02.03
MFC tip  (0) 2011.01.25
OLEDB  (0) 2011.01.24
COM  (0) 2011.01.24
MFC 기초 정리  (0) 2011.01.21